Vitamin B12 (Methylcobalamin, Injectable)
Injectable methylcobalamin — the active, bioavailable B12 form. Far superior absorption vs oral for those with absorption issues, high stress, or Metformin use. Supports nerve function, red blood cell production, DNA synthesis, energy metabolism, and mood. Essential monitoring marker on Metformin.
